2-Mobile Technologies 3G in review
Data Transmission speed increased from 144kbps- 2Mbps. Providing Faster Communication Send/Receive Large Email Messages High Speed Web / More Security Video Conferencing / 3D Gaming TV Streaming/ Mobile TV/ Phone Calls
Drawbacks Of 3G High Bandwidth Requirement
Expensive 3G Phones.
Large Cell Phones

CDMA is fixed assignment access technique that uses spread spectrum and a special kind of coding scheme to allow the transmitters to share the media at the same time.
CDMA modulation steps:1-Generate a local Pseudo-Random code with a higher rate
than the data to be transmitted.2-XOR the data which need to be transmitted with the
generated code.

2-Mobile Technologies4G
Capable of providing 100Mbps – 1Gbps speed. More Security High Speed High Capacity Low Cost Per-bit LTE stands for Long Term EvolutionNext Generation mobile broadband technologyPromises data transfer rates of 100 MbpsBased on UMTS 3G technologyOptimized for All-IP traffic
